'Hulkenberg and I entered Formula 1 at the wrong time'
Romain Grosjean believes that he has never had a real chance in Formula 1. The Haas F1 driver never stood out in front of a top team and that may have killed him that he has to leave now. Grosjean himself believes that he entered the pinnacle of motorsport at the wrong time. "When I think about it, the 1986/1987 generation was perhaps the wrong one to be in. Paul di Resta, Nico Hülkenberg, myself and perhaps Sebastian Buemi as well; we all came in at a time when the seats on the top teams were occupied and the 'old men' didn't want to leave Formula 1 yet. The youngsters came after it and we never really got our chance", says Grosjean in the 'In The Pink' podcast. Read...
